PEG-MGF (PEGylated Mechano Growth Factor) is a synthetic, PEGylated variant of MGF (Mechano Growth Factor), which is itself a splice variant of IGF-1 (specifically the IGF-1Ec isoform in humans). Natural MGF is produced locally in muscle tissue in response to mechanical overload (resistance exercise) or tissue damage. It activates muscle satellite cells - the resident stem cells responsible for muscle repair, regeneration, and hypertrophy. However, natural MGF has an extremely short half-life (minutes), limiting its therapeutic utility.

How it works
MGF (Mechano Growth Factor) is an autocrine splice variant of IGF-1, produced locally in muscle tissue after mechanical overload or damage. The unique C-terminal E domain of MGF (24 amino acids differing from IGF-1Ea) is responsible for its satellite cell activating properties. MGF binds to a distinct receptor (not the IGF-1R) on muscle satellite cells, triggering their activation from quiescence (G0) into the cell cycle.
Upon activation, satellite cells proliferate (expanding the pool of myogenic precursors) and then, under influence of other growth factors including IGF-1Ea, differentiate into myoblasts that fuse with existing muscle fibers or form new fibers. This process is essential for muscle hypertrophy, repair, and regeneration. MGF specifically drives the proliferation phase - creating more satellite cells - while IGF-1Ea drives the differentiation and fusion phase.
PEGylation extends the circulating half-life from ~5-7 minutes (unmodified MGF) to several hours, enabling effective dosing via intramuscular injection. The PEG chain protects the peptide from enzymatic degradation without significantly altering receptor binding. PEG-MGF can act both locally (when injected into specific muscle groups) and systemically to promote satellite cell activation throughout the body.

Regulatory status
Not FDA-approved for any indication. Available as a research peptide only (sold 'for research purposes' or 'not for human consumption'). Listed as a prohibited substance by WADA (World Anti-Doping Agency) under S2 - Peptide Hormones, Growth Factors. No pharmaceutical-grade product exists. Purity varies between research suppliers.
